Lahore – PML-N leader Nawaz Sharif met Chang Ping Zhao, the former CEO and founder of global cryptocurrency platform Binance, in Lahore. Chief Minister of Punjab Maryam Nawaz and CEO of Pakistan Crypto Council Bilal bin Saqib were also present at the meeting.

During the meeting, Chang Ping Zhao was welcomed to be appointed as a strategic advisor to the Pakistan Crypto Council. On the occasion, detailed discussions were held on digital assets, blockchain technology, and promoting youth engagement in the technology sector.

According to the statement, Chang Ping Zhao highlighted the emerging blockchain technology and global entrepreneurship opportunities in Pakistan. He said that Pakistan has the potential to become a regional hub in the digital economy.

During the conversation, Nawaz Sharif said that international personalities like Chang Ping Zhao open new avenues of development. Pakistan is ready to adopt innovative changes and modern technologies. He said Pakistan has to adapt itself to the demands of the future.

Punjab Chief Minister Maryam Nawaz said that the Punjab government is enabling the youth to participate in the global digital market by teaching them IT skills. He said that our focus is on knowledge-based technology so that the new generation can be taken forward in the field of digital enterprise and modern business.

According to the statement, during the meeting, Chang Ping Zhao appreciated the digital skills of Pakistani youth and said that with their appointment, Pakistan will move towards becoming a regional hub in the field of Web3 and digital finance. At the end of the meeting, both sides agreed to enhance mutual cooperation for digital transformation, blockchain, and development of future technologies.
